Aircraft System Protection
The ADTS 405 protects the aircraft system against user error and leaks in the aircraft
system.
Note: The pumps must be switched on.
The system protection operates:
Limit checking of user entered set-points.
Automatic regain of control if leak rate is over limit during leak testing.
Automatic regain of control if a leak takes the system pressures outside of
limits.
Mach Test and Constant Mach
To go to 0.8 Mach, enter Control Mode and proceed as follows:
Press SPEED then RATE to select rate of change of airspeed.
Enter required rate, e.g. 300 kts/min.
Press MACH.
Enter 0.8.
Wait for the Mach to be achieved.
Note: If the altitude changes the system automatically adjusts the airspeed to
keep the Mach value constant.
True Airspeed
The normal airspeed parameter is Calibrated Airspeed (CAS) (equivalent to IAS for
testing purposes).
The airspeed parameter may be changed to True Airspeed (TAS) as follows:
Press SETUP then SPEED.
Select [CAS/TAS].
Select [TAS].
Press QUIT/CLEAR repeatedly to exit set-up.
Press SPEED.
The display now shows the airspeed parameter as TAS.
Note: Airspeed parameter type can only be changed in Full Set-up mode. Rate of
change of airspeed will still be shown as Rate CAS.
Pitot temperature (Tt) is used in the calculation of TAS. To enter Tt:
Press SETUP.
Press SPEED.
Select [Pt TEMPERATURE].
Enter the temperature measured by the aircraft's Pitot temperature sensor.
Press QUIT/CLEAR three times to return to user display.
Note: Pitot temperature can only be changed in Full Set-up mode.
